Output 64c1623b66ddfeaaa0444f8b4327dcff83584237c15792ea7aa15409fd20785a:108

value
1251233
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b995f745133be8d6dc6762a734dbc13c138e3482 OP_EQUALVERIFY OP_CHECKSIG
address
1HvHfJWWTMt4aF8zC3XXRZHCtdXQWZmJMZ
transaction
64c1623b66ddfeaaa0444f8b4327dcff83584237c15792ea7aa15409fd20785a
spent
true